If you paint the edges of those after you have put them together (and glued/taped them?) a light grey, then it will look about 10% better. Just a thought at least, you don't get those white paper edges that sometimes ruins the illusion. |
I too am a miniature painter and I've never thought about that at all and I make all sort of cardstock buildings for that hobby :eek: . That is a great tip :cool: .
thank you :) BTW I do clear coat them to make them last a long time, which is something I forgot to mention. |
Smart thing to mention! (The clearcoat) - I forgot on some pieces I made and they shriveled up and died after some (ab)use. :rolleyes:
I think I read the painting edges of the cardboard/paper thing in white dwarf magazine when I was playing Mordheim, and did so to all of the buildings in the starter set there. (To all of you who know what I'm blabbering on about: 10 geek points!) :D |
I guess I get the ten geek pointsthen and I'll give you ten more if for know what Battletech is. :D
one other tip about clear coating the cardstock. Tape the bottom of the models down with masking tape or they will blow away once you spay them. |
Very true, just a small detail extra, paint right underneath the edge as well - even if its at an awkward angle it will create the illusion of not being paper all around.
